Is it difficult to predict the weather through satellite cloud images?
It is a complex and difficult job to accurately predict the weather according to satellite cloud pictures. First of all, forecasters are required to have strong professional knowledge, carry out data analysis, picture comparison, calculate the thickness and running speed of clouds, and master and analyze theoretical data. Secondly, we should have rich climate experience and compare the factors that affect the development and direction of clouds, geological conditions, ocean currents, wind speed, temperature difference and so on. . . . Conduct a comprehensive analysis. It takes a lot of careful work to get a detailed weather report.
